The 2012-built RV Angkor Pandaw ship cruises in Vietnam (on the Red River/Hong River and Halong Bay) departing from homeports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City/Saigon.
The riverboat was once initially chartered by Avalon Waterways (under the name "Avalon Angkor") but in 2015, it was replaced by Avalon Siem Reap.
The Angkor Pandaw vessel was the industry's first Mekong-based riverboat cruising the full route from Saigon (Vietnam) to Siem Reap (Cambodia), and the reverse.
This luxurious ship was designed specifically to go where other boats are unable to, without sacrificing any comforts and amenities that the tourists expect from the premium Pandaw Cruises company.
Due to the ship's design (allowing full itineraries between Siem Reap and Saigon) are eliminated over 7 hours of motorcoach travel to and from the embarkation/disembarkation port.
Onboard, Angkor Pandaw passengers can truly immerse themselves in the culture and sights along the river. This extraordinary vessel was made by traditional craftsmen. It is hand-finished in teak and brass, featuring Southasia's colonial charm.
Time onboard delivers a refreshing experience, as all of the staterooms open to the open-air lounge and the outside.

Angkor Pandaw has 2 walk-around passenger decks and identical cabins of 16 m2 (170 ft2).
All staterooms offer as standard amenities twin beds (some converting to double, all with premium mattresses, quality linens, duvet, two kinds of pillows), French windows, air-conditioning, spacious wardrobe, electronic safe box (in the closet), writing desk (vanity with chair and make-up mirror), under-bed storage (for suitcases), en-suite bathroom (WC, shower, washbasin, hairdryer, towels, slippers, bathrobes/kimonos, Spa-branded amenities), unlimited bottled water, Yoga mats (for in-cabin use), nightly turndown service.
Shipboard 24-hour laundry is also available.
On all shore excursions are provided shoe cleaning and cold towel services (after), bottled water (Pandaw-branded aluminium bottles as giveaways), first aid-trained assistant guide.
